Coteccons Day expands from internal gathering to community engagement

Coteccons Day 2026 broadens its scope from internal bonding activities to include workers, their families, and the wider community, supported by numerous partners.

Coteccons Day, an annual event in august, has traditionally been a time for the Coteccons team to reflect on its journey, connect with colleagues, and share project updates. In previous years, the program primarily focused on internal appreciation and bonding activities for employees.

For 2026, under the theme "Coteccons 20+2 | United To Rise", the program significantly expands its reach. It now encompasses a series of activities across more than 100 construction sites nationwide, including the United Day - Happy Coffee Truck, the United Thanks initiative to recognize safety-conscious workers, the Xay nen uoc mo scholarship program, the United Run virtual race, and the United Corner competition.

Coteccons Day 2026 is organized at over 100 Coteccons construction sites nationwide. Photo: Coteccons

This expansion marks a shift from an internal event to a community-oriented celebration. The activities now target not only employees and engineers but also workers, their families, and other groups contributing to society.

Bolat Duisenov, Chairman of the Board, emphasized the company's evolving role regarding the community. He stated that after years of commitment to building a company that creates value for people and society, the "20+2" milestone is an opportunity for Coteccons to clearly define its responsibilities as an Industry Leader in Vietnam's new development phase.

A tangible change is visible directly at the construction sites. Happy Coffee Trucks, laden with coffee, beverages, and gifts, have visited workers from subcontractor companies at over 100 sites and offices across the country.

With Coteccons Day, workers have another annual event to anticipate. Photo: Coteccons

The spirit of connection extends through the United Run, where Coteccons employees and engineers participate in the national walking event "Cung Viet Nam tien buoc". This event, organized by Nhan Dan Newspaper, the Ministry of Public Security, the Ministry of National Defense, and the Ho Chi Minh Communist Youth Union Central Committee, aims to achieve "10 billion green steps - For a sustainable Vietnam".

Furthermore, Coteccons employees successfully completed a challenge to cover 40,075 km in 22 days, marking the company's 22nd anniversary. This distance, equivalent to one trip around the Earth, symbolizes Coteccons' collaborative spirit and its "Go Global" ambition.

Another initiative, United Corner, encourages the adoption of the 3R model (reduce, reuse, and recycle) at construction sites, integrated with "Saving Mode" solutions. While 3R focuses on efficient resource utilization, Saving Mode aims to optimize operations, minimize waste, improve construction methods, and enhance productivity through technology and digitalization. These concepts are implemented from offices to sites, linked to specific operational activities.

Bags of rice are presented to workers who demonstrate excellent occupational safety practices. Photo: Coteccons

United Thanks, another key activity of Coteccons Day 2026, involves donating rice, representing 10,000 words of appreciation, to workers who demonstrate excellent occupational safety practices.

Safety is a mandatory principle at every construction site. Coteccons maintains safety by helping workers understand the value of protecting themselves and their teammates. The bags of rice from the United Thanks program convey gratitude to those who uphold safety standards, while also serving as a reminder that behind every safe workday lies the peace of a family awaiting their return.

Coteccons Day further expands its impact through the Xay nen uoc mo scholarship program. In its second year, the program awards 600 scholarships: 350 to children of workers at 84 Coteccons sites nationwide, and the remaining 250 to children of workers from five urban environmental sanitation and drainage companies in TP HCM, Ha Noi, and Da Nang. This acknowledges the silent contributions of those vital to urban operations.

The Xay nen uoc mo scholarship program supports children of construction, environmental sanitation, and urban drainage workers with good academic achievements. Photo: Coteccons

These community-focused activities are made possible through the collaboration of investors, subcontractors, and partners such as Boss Tang luc ca phe, Revive The thao, HSBC, Berocca, and Standard Chartered, among others. The participation of these parties not only expands the scale of the activities but also demonstrates how various stakeholders in the construction value chain unite to foster a culture of gratitude and create positive value for the community.
